Transforming Documents | 291If you want an XSLT scenario select as Scenario type either <strong>XML</strong> transformation with XSLT or XSLT transformationthen complete the dialog as follows:Figure 125: The Configure Transformation Dialog - XSLT Tab• <strong>XML</strong> URL - Specifies an input <strong>XML</strong> file to be used for the transformation. Please note that this URL is resolvedthrough the catalog resolver. If the catalog does not have a mapping for the URL, then the file will be used directly.Note: If the transformer engine is Saxon 9 and a custom URI resolver is configured in Preferences forSaxon 9, then the <strong>XML</strong> input of the transformation is passed to that URI resolver.Note: If the transformer engine is one of the built-in XSLT 2.0 engines and the name of an initial templateis specified in the scenario then the <strong>XML</strong> URL field can be empty. The <strong>XML</strong> URL field can also be emptyin case of external XSLT processors. In all other cases a non-empty <strong>XML</strong> URL value is mandatory.The following buttons are shown immediately after the input field:• Insert Editor Variables - Opens a pop-up menu allowing to introduce special <strong>Oxygen</strong> <strong>XML</strong> <strong>Author</strong> <strong>plugin</strong>editor variables or custom editor variables in the <strong>XML</strong> URL field.• Browse for local file - Opens a local file browser dialog allowing to select a local file for the text field.• Browse for remote file - Opens an URL browser dialog allowing to select a remote file for the text field.• Browse for archived file - Opens a zip archive browser dialog allowing to select a file from a zip archivethat will be inserted in the text field.•• Open in editor - Opens the file with the path specified in the text field in an editor panel.• XSL URL - Specifies an input XSL file to be used for the transformation. Please note that this URL is resolvedthrough the catalog resolver. If the catalog does not have a mapping for the URL, thenthe file will be used directly.The set of browsing buttons described above for the <strong>XML</strong> URL field are also available for the XSL URL field.• Use "xml-stylesheet" declaration - Use the stylesheet declared with an xml-stylesheet declaration insteadof the stylesheet specified in the XSL URL field. By default this checkbox is not selected and the transformationapplies the XSLT stylesheet specified in the XSL URL field. If it is checked the scenario applies the stylesheetspecified explicitly in the <strong>XML</strong> document with the xml-stylesheet processing instruction.
